The Complete Idiot's Guide(r) to Running, Third Edition, offers instruction on developing ideal running techniques for personal fitness or competition. Through easy-to-follow steps designed to gradually build their abilities, readers learn how to choose reliable running gear and create an effective training and running program.
Features expert tips on nutrition, reducing stress with exercise, avoiding and treating injuries, and entering 5K, 10K, and half and full marathons
Provides basic training plans and illustrations of stretching positions, muscle diagrams, running apparel, and more

Bill Rodgers has won the Boston Marathon and New York City Marathon four times each. In 1998, Rodgers was inducted to the National Distance Running Hall of Fame, and in 1999, he was inducted to the National Track & Field Hall of Fame.
Scott Douglas is a former editor-in-cheif of Running Times magazine and a frequent contributor to many national running publications.
